2013-03-30 74 views
0

我打電話一個javascript函數一樣如何使用JavaScript

echo "<td name='patient' width='60px' class='filter' Onclick='patient($id,$pid,$sid);return false;' ><a >".$pid."</a></td>"; 

這裏pid是像242或三分之二百四十三或243 @ 3通過與串/或任何其他特殊字符。

如果它是一個數字它的工作pefect。

但特殊字符它不起作用

任何幫助嗎?

+0

'進行urlencode($ PID)使用escape(variable name)'? – Tushar

+0

你想讓他們在JavaScript中是什麼類型的?數字?字符串? – Xymostech

+0

@Xymostech它來自數據庫。我無法確認,特別是 – jaya

回答

2

試試這個

echo "<td name='patient' width='60px' class='filter'>"; 
echo "<a href='#' onclick='patient(\"".$id."\",\"".$pid."\",\"".$sid."\");return false;'>".$pid."</a></td>"; 
0

你可以在javascript函數